In today's global economy, the concept of domestic value plays a crucial role in understanding the economic landscape of a country. The term domestic value refers to the worth of goods and services produced within a country's borders, taking into account the labor, resources, and capital that contribute to their creation. This notion is particularly important when discussing trade balances, economic growth, and national policies aimed at promoting local industries.One of the primary reasons why domestic value is significant is that it helps to measure a nation's economic health. When a country produces more goods and services with a higher domestic value, it indicates a robust economy that can support its citizens through job creation and increased income levels. For instance, countries that invest heavily in technology and innovation often see a rise in domestic value as they create high-quality products that command premium prices in both domestic and international markets.Moreover, understanding domestic value is essential for policymakers who aim to enhance their nation's competitiveness. By focusing on increasing the domestic value of local products, governments can implement strategies that encourage local manufacturing, promote exports, and reduce reliance on imported goods. This not only strengthens the economy but also fosters a sense of national pride and identity among citizens, as they support homegrown businesses.Another aspect to consider is the impact of globalization on domestic value. While globalization has led to increased competition and opportunities for countries to engage in international trade, it has also posed challenges for maintaining domestic value. Many businesses face pressure to outsource production to lower-cost countries, which can diminish the domestic value of their products. Therefore, it is vital for businesses to find a balance between cost efficiency and maintaining a strong domestic value in order to remain competitive.In addition, consumers play a pivotal role in influencing domestic value. As awareness grows regarding the importance of supporting local economies, many consumers are choosing to buy products that are made domestically. This shift in consumer behavior not only helps to increase the domestic value of products but also encourages companies to invest in local production facilities. By prioritizing local sourcing, businesses can contribute to the overall economic stability of their communities.In conclusion, the concept of domestic value is integral to understanding a country's economic dynamics. It encompasses the worth of locally produced goods and services, reflecting the contributions of labor, resources, and capital. As nations navigate the complexities of globalization, it becomes increasingly important to focus on enhancing domestic value through supportive policies, consumer choices, and investment in local industries. Ultimately, a strong domestic value not only benefits the economy but also enriches the lives of its citizens by fostering job creation and sustainable growth.
